Peri-conceptional progesterone treatment in women with unexplained recurrent miscarriage: a randomized double-blind placebo-controlled trial

Progesterone is more effective than placebo in reducing the risk of miscarriage if administered in the luteal phase of the cycle, before confirmation of pregnancy in women with history of unexplained RM.
